Part I

“DREAMS, PASSIONS

“He first recalls that uneasiness of soul, that _vague des passions_, those moments of causeless melancholy and joy, which he experienced before seeing her whom he loves; then the volcanic love with which she suddenly inspired him, his moments of delirious anguish, of jealous fury, his returns to loving tenderness, and his religious consolations.

“ Part II “A BALL

“He sees his beloved at a ball, in the midst of the tumult of a brilliant fête.
